Key Capabilities and User Interaction
- The Firefly AI Assistant works across multiple Adobe Creative Cloud applications, including Photoshop, Premiere, Lightroom, Express, and Illustrator, according to TechCrunch.
- Users control the AI assistant's outputs using text prompts, buttons, and sliders; the assistant suggests actions and orchestrates workflows across apps, TechCrunch reported.
- Firefly’s AI models now include Kling 3.0 and Kling 3.0 Omni, joining existing models from Google, Runway, and ElevenLabs, according to Adobe Newsroom.
- Precision Flow and AI Markup features are live, enabling creators to explore image variations and paint edits directly onto photos, stated The Shortcut | Matt Swider.
- Adobe is exploring how its AI assistants can work better with third-party large language models, TechCrunch detailed.

How Does Firefly AI Integrate with Creative Suite?
Adobe positions Firefly as an open, extensible platform, not just an in-house AI solution. This strategy leverages external AI models and integrates with other large language models. Firefly’s inclusion of third-party AI models like Kling 3.0, Google, Runway, and ElevenLabs signals a strategic pivot from proprietary tool dominance. Adobe aims to become a central orchestrator of a broader AI-powered creative ecosystem, suggesting a future where creative AI is not locked into a single ecosystem.
